hi,all:

I tried to build psqlodbc-07.03.0260 on FreeBSD 5.4(i386 machine) but failed.

When I run "./configure --with-unixodbc" in the psqlodbc source dir and the following was given:

checking for a BSD-compatible install... /usr/bin/install -c
checking whether build environment is sane... yes
checking for gawk... no
checking for mawk... no
checking for nawk... nawk
checking whether make sets $(MAKE)... yes
checking whether to enable maintainer-specific portions of Makefiles... no
checking for style of include used by make... GNU
checking for gcc... gcc
checking for C compiler default output file name... a.out
checking whether the C compiler works... yes
checking whether we are cross compiling... no
checking for suffix of executables...
checking for suffix of object files... o
checking whether we are using the GNU C compiler... yes
checking whether gcc accepts -g... yes
checking for gcc option to accept ANSI C... none needed
checking dependency style of gcc... gcc3
checking for SQLGetPrivateProfileString in -lodbcinst... no
configure: error: unixODBC driver manager not found

I have already installed unixODBC-2.2.11 which is working well on my machine.

But ,what is the problem of building psqlodbc and how can i fix it?
